Understanding Transfer Agents: Essential Roles in Securities Management

In the world of finance and investment, the term “transfer agent” may not always be at the forefront of investors’ minds. However, this role is crucial in managing securities and ensuring smooth transactions between buyers and sellers. Understanding the function and significance of transfer agents can greatly enhance your investment strategy and overall market knowledge.

Transfer agents are responsible for maintaining accurate records of securities ownership. They manage the transfer of stocks, bonds, and other financial instruments, ensuring that ownership is correctly recorded whenever a security is bought or sold. This process is vital for maintaining the integrity of the securities market, as it helps prevent fraud and errors in ownership records. Additionally, transfer agents handle other essential functions, such as distributing dividends and managing corporate actions like stock splits and mergers.

The role of a transfer agent encompasses several critical tasks. They verify and process transactions, issue new shares, and manage communication between issuers and shareholders. By ensuring that all transfers are completed accurately and efficiently, transfer agents play a vital role in the liquidity of securities. Their work helps maintain investor confidence, which is essential for the smooth functioning of financial markets.

Furthermore, transfer agents often serve as the main point of contact for shareholders. They provide essential information about holdings, address inquiries, and facilitate the transfer of ownership during sales or inheritances. This support is particularly important for investors who may not be familiar with the complexities of securities management.

In the age of digital finance, the responsibilities of transfer agents have evolved. With the rise of alternative trading systems and electronic trading platforms, the demand for efficient and reliable transfer services has increased. Transfer agents now often employ advanced technologies to streamline their processes, ensuring timely and accurate transactions. This shift not only enhances efficiency but also improves the overall experience for investors.
